Ground Beef and Hash Brown Potato Casserole Recipe
INGREDIENTS:
30 oz. frozen hash browns - thawed
1 pd. ground beef
1 cup diced onions
1 1/2 cups diced mushrooms
1 cup frozen peas
4 cloves minced garlic
2 cans cream of mushroom soup
1/2 can milk
2 cups shredded cheddar cheese - divided
salt and pepper to taste
In a skillet on med high heat add ground beef. Chop and cook until no longer pink.
Drain excess fat.
Add onions, mushrooms and pinch of black pepper.
Cook and stir for 3-5 minutes or until onions change color.
Add frozen peas and minced garlic.
Cook and stir for one minute and then remove from heat.
In large bowl add thawed hash browns, cream of soups, half of shredded cheeze, milk and black pepper.
Mix well to combine.
Add meat/vegetable mixture to hash browns and stir to combine.
Pour mixture into lightly greased 9 x 13 baking dish and level out.
Sprinkle top with other half of cheese.
Bake 350 degrees for 40-45 minutes or until slightly golden and bubbly.
Let rest for 10 minutes before serving.
Garnish with chopped chives.
Serve and enjoy.

Beef Broccoli Casserole || The Keto Kitchen
[RECIPE BELOW] Beef Broccoli Casserole.
Super simple, really flavorsome and filling - why not have a quick dinner tonight?
| The Recipe |
INGREDIENTS:
- 500g (1lb) Ground Beef
- 400g (14oz) Canned Tomatoes - ALWAYS CHECK CARBS BEFORE BUYING
- 340g (12oz) Broccoli Florets
- 170g (6oz) Cheddar Cheese, shredded
- 25g (0.8oz) Parmesan Cheese
- 1 tsp Salt
- 1 tsp Garlic Powder
- 1/4 tsp Cayenne Pepper
METHOD:
1. Preheat oven to 190c/375f. Prepare a medium baking dish.
2. Cut any broccoli florets larger than 2 inches into smaller pieces and add the broccoli to a large microwave-safe bowl. Cover and microwave until tender, about 5 minutes. Set aside.
3. In a large pan, over medium heat, cook the ground beef until browned, about 7 minutes, breaking it apart as it cooks. Drain and return beef to the heat.
4. Add tomatoes, salt, garlic powder and cayenne to the pan. Mix and simmer for at least 10 minutes to thicken. Stir occasionally.
5. To your prepared baking dish, add broccoli, beef mixture and half of the cheddar cheese. Mix well.
6. Top with the remaining cheddar cheese and the parmesan cheese.
7. Bake for 20 minutes or until the casserole begins bubbling at the sides. Let it rest for about 10 minutes before cutting into it.
Please note, all macros are calculated with My Fitness Pal and may vary on ingredients used.
Serves 4:
Per Serving:
Calories: 366kcal
Fat: 19g
Protein: 37g
Net Carbs: 4g

One of My Favorite Meals Reinvented! Smothered Cabbage & Ground Beef Recipe
INGREDIENTS
- cabbage
- 1 ½ lb ground beef
- 1 TB tomato paste
- 14 oz tomato sauce
- red pepper
- green pepper
- white onion
- salt/pepper
- 1tsp cajun seasoning
- 2 TB garlic powder
All given measurements are an approximation and meant to be tailored to suit your individual preferences and dietary needs!

Ground Beef and Cabbage Casserole
Ground beef and cabbage casserole is a delicious dairy-free and gluten-free dinner that can be made ahead of time and baked when you’re ready to eat. It’s made with ground beef, onions, garlic, herbs, rice, tomatoes, cabbage, and cheese. This healthy dish is perfect for busy nights when you want a tasty meal but don’t have much time to make it.
1 pound ground beef
3 tbsp olive oil
1 medium white onion, chopped
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 tbsp herbs de Provence
1 cup rice
1 can tomato puree
3 tbsp tomato paste
1 2⁄3 cup beef stock
1 medium white cabbage, shredded
2 cups mozzarella cheese, shredded
2⁄3 cup parmesan, shredded
